Precise calculation. A living language for your pair.
The strict traditional structure stays underneath. On the homepage, the focus stays on what matters first: how different ways of loving become easier to recognize.
Inner temperament
Varna · 1 pointHow easily you read each other's basic inner pace.
Influence between two people
Vashya · 2 pointsWho tends to lead, who follows more softly, and whether the exchange feels mutual.
Support and recovery
Tara · 3 pointsWhether contact helps each of you regain steadiness and move forward.
Rhythm of closeness
Yoni · 4 pointsHow naturally habits, body, and wordless responses meet.
Friendship of minds
Maitri · 5 pointsHow easily you hear, explain, and respect each other's way of thinking.
Behavior in closeness
Gana · 6 pointsHow character appears beside another person: softer, clearer, steadier, or sharper.
Shared direction
Bhakuta · 7 pointsHow home, plans, ambition, and the imagined shape of life line up.
Rhythm of state
Nadi · 8 pointsHow you calm down, overload, and affect each other's inner state.
